Section 24

Change of name of existing private limited companies

(1) In the case of a company which was a private limited company immediately before the commencement of this Act, the Registrar shall enter the word "Private" before the word "Limited" in the name of the company upon the register and shall also make the necessary alterations in the certificate of incorporation issued to the company and in its memorandum of association. (2) Sub-section (3) of Section 23 shall apply to a change of name under sub-section (1), as it applies to a change of name under Section 21.
